vue的是什么软件

fiy 其他 8

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Vue是一个用于构建用户界面的开源JavaScript框架。它由Evan You在2014年创建,并得到了全球开发者的广泛认可和使用。Vue的目标是通过提供一种简单、灵活和高效的方式来构建交互式的Web界面。

    Vue的设计理念是将界面的不同部分拆分成组件,每个组件负责特定的功能和显示,然后通过组合这些组件来构建完整的应用程序。Vue还提供了响应式的数据绑定机制,使得页面中的数据能够与界面保持同步,当数据发生变化时,界面会自动更新。

    Vue具有以下特点:

    1. 简单易学:Vue的核心库只关注视图层,易于上手和使用。同时,它也提供了完善的文档和丰富的学习资源,帮助开发者快速入门。

    2. 渐进式框架:Vue被设计为渐进式框架,这意味着你可以根据项目的需要逐步引入Vue的功能,而不需要一次性引入全部功能。这种灵活性使得Vue可以轻松集成到现有项目中。

    3. 组件化开发:Vue鼓励将页面拆分成更小、更可复用的组件,这样可以提高代码的可维护性和重用性。Vue的组件可以相互嵌套和通信,使得开发人员可以更加灵活地构建复杂的用户界面。

    4. 响应式数据绑定:Vue采用了虚拟DOM和响应式数据绑定的机制,当数据发生变化时,Vue会智能地更新视图,减少了手动操作DOM的复杂性和性能开销。

    5. 生态系统丰富:Vue拥有庞大的生态系统,有许多开源的插件和工具可供使用,如Vuex用于管理应用的状态、Vue Router用于构建单页应用的路由等。

    总的来说,Vue是一个功能强大、灵活易用的前端开发框架,适用于构建各种规模的Web应用程序。它的设计理念和特点使得它成为目前最受欢迎的JavaScript框架之一。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Vue是一款开源的前端JavaScript框架,用于构建用户界面。它是一种渐进式框架,可以逐步应用到现有的项目中,也可以作为一个完整的SPA(单页面应用程序)进行开发。Vue.js提供了一套简洁、易用的API,使开发者可以更高效地构建用户界面。

    以下是关于Vue框架的五个要点:

    1. 轻量级:Vue.js非常轻量,文件大小只有20KB左右,因此在加载和渲染速度上表现出色。这使得Vue.js在移动端开发中非常受欢迎。

    2. 数据驱动:Vue.js采用了双向数据绑定的概念,即当数据发生变化时,视图自动更新;而当视图发生交互时,数据也自动更新。这个特性帮助开发者更加高效地开发复杂的应用程序。

    3. 组件化开发:Vue.js将页面拆分为各个独立的组件,每个组件都有自己的逻辑和样式,并可以互相组合。这种组件化的开发方式使得代码更加可复用、可维护,并且可以提高开发效率。

    4. 简洁易学:Vue.js的语法非常简洁易懂,只需要通过一些基本的指令和模板,就可以完成常见的功能。与此同时,Vue.js还提供了丰富的扩展,可以满足更复杂的需求。

    5. 生态系统完善:Vue.js具有庞大且活跃的社区,有大量的插件和工具可供选择。同时,Vue.js与其他框架(如React和Angular)之间也可以无缝集成,使开发者能够充分利用各种工具和资源。

    总的来说,Vue.js作为一款简单、高效、灵活的前端框架,为开发者提供了一种快速构建用户界面的方式,并且具备良好的可维护性和扩展性。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Vue.js是一种用于构建用户界面的开源JavaScript框架,是一种MVVM(Model-View-ViewModel)模式的前端框架。Vue.js具有轻量级、灵活、高效的特点,被广泛应用于单页面应用(SPA)的开发。Vue.js采用了响应式数据绑定和组件化的开发方式,使得开发者可以更加容易地构建可维护和可测试的Web应用。

    下面将从几个方面具体介绍Vue.js的特点及使用方法。

    1. 响应式数据绑定:
      Vue.js采用了数据驱动和双向绑定的机制,通过指令将数据和DOM进行关联,一旦数据发生变化,界面也会随之更新。这种响应式数据绑定使得开发者能够简化对界面的操作,提高开发效率。

    2. 组件化开发:
      Vue.js将界面拆分为独立的组件,每个组件都具有自己独立的逻辑和样式,可以高度复用,并且不会相互干扰。Vue.js的组件可以嵌套使用,形成组件树,通过props和emit进行父子组件之间的通信。

    3. 虚拟DOM:
      Vue.js使用虚拟DOM(Virtual DOM)技术,在数据变化时,通过对比新旧虚拟DOM树,只更新需要修改的部分,以提高性能和效率。

    4. 模板语法:
      Vue.js采用了类似于HTML的模板语法,可通过插值、指令、事件绑定等方式与数据进行交互。模板语法简洁明了,易于上手。

    5. 强大的工具生态系统:
      Vue.js拥有大量的插件和工具,可以与其他库和框架无缝集成,如Vue Router用于前端路由管理、Vuex用于状态管理、Vue CLI用于快速构建项目等。

    在使用Vue.js之前,需要先安装Vue.js的开发环境。可以通过CDN引入Vue.js,也可以通过npm安装Vue.js。

    使用Vue.js的步骤如下:

    1. 创建Vue实例:在HTML文件中添加一个占位元素作为挂载点,并创建一个Vue实例。
    2. 声明数据与视图的关联:在Vue实例中声明数据,使用指令和插值将数据与视图进行关联。
    3. 响应用户交互:监听事件,通过方法响应用户的点击、输入等交互操作。
    4. 使用组件:将界面拆分为独立的组件,通过组件树的方式组织应用的逻辑和样式。
    5. 发布至生产环境:通过构建工具将项目发布至生产环境,优化代码,并进行压缩和混淆。

    总的来说,Vue.js 是一个灵活、高效、易用的JavaScript框架,可用于构建用户界面。它具有响应式数据绑定、组件化开发、虚拟DOM等特点,提供了一种简洁明了的模板语法,并拥有强大的工具生态系统。通过安装和使用Vue.js的步骤,开发者可以快速构建出高效、可维护的Web应用。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部